/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} Experience the Thrill of Mad Casino & Sportsbook 1242496487

Experience the Thrill of Mad Casino & Sportsbook 1242496487

Experience the Thrill of Mad Casino & Sportsbook 1242496487

In the vibrant realm of online gambling, Mad Casino & Sportsbook Mad casino & Sportsbook stands out as a premier destination for enthusiasts seeking both casino games and sports betting. With a user-friendly interface, a vast selection of games, and exciting sports betting options, Mad Casino & Sportsbook has become a go-to platform for players around the world.

Introduction to Mad Casino & Sportsbook

Launched in recent years, Mad Casino & Sportsbook has quickly gained a reputation for offering an exhilarating gambling experience. The platform provides an extensive selection of games, including traditional casino favorites, innovative slots, and a comprehensive sportsbook. What truly sets Mad Casino apart is its commitment to providing an entertaining and secure environment for all users.

Game Variety at Mad Casino

Mad Casino features an impressive array of casino games designed to cater to all tastes and skill levels. Whether you are a fan of classic table games like blackjack and roulette or prefer the thrill of modern video slots, you will find something to enjoy.

Slot Games

The slot selection at Mad Casino is nothing short of extraordinary. Players can explore a variety of themes, from mythology and adventure to popular movies and TV shows. The platform is continually updating its collection, ensuring that players have access to the latest and most exciting titles in the industry.

Experience the Thrill of Mad Casino & Sportsbook 1242496487

Table Games

If you enjoy the strategic elements of table games, Mad Casino offers an exciting lineup. Here, players can engage in various versions of blackjack, poker, and roulette. The live dealer section adds an extra dimension, allowing players to interact with real dealers while enjoying the game from the comfort of their homes.

Sports Betting Options

For sports enthusiasts, Mad Casino & Sportsbook takes the experience to another level with its extensive sportsbook. Covering a wide variety of sports, including football, basketball, tennis, and more, the sportsbook offers competitive odds and numerous betting options.

Live Betting

The live betting feature allows players to place bets on ongoing events, providing them with the chance to engage in the action as it unfolds. This real-time betting experience is perfect for those looking to enhance their sports viewing with an added layer of excitement.

Betting Promotions and Bonuses

To attract new players and reward loyal customers, Mad Casino & Sportsbook offers a range of promotions and bonuses. New players can take advantage of welcome bonuses that enhance their initial deposits, giving them more funds to explore the vast array of games and betting options.

Experience the Thrill of Mad Casino & Sportsbook 1242496487

User Experience and Interface

One of the standout features of Mad Casino is its user-friendly interface. Navigating through the site is a breeze, allowing players to find their favorite games or sports events quickly. The site is mobile-responsive, offering a seamless experience on smartphones and tablets. This flexibility is crucial for players who want to enjoy gaming on the go.

Security and Fair Play

When it comes to online gambling, security is paramount. Mad Casino & Sportsbook prioritizes the safety of its players by utilizing advanced encryption technology to protect sensitive information. Additionally, the platform is licensed and regulated, ensuring fair play and giving players peace of mind as they enjoy their favorite games.

Customer Support

Another important aspect of a top-tier online casino and sportsbook is customer support. Mad Casino offers reliable customer service through various channels, including live chat, email, and frequently asked questions (FAQs). The support team is available to assist players with inquiries, resolving issues promptly and efficiently.

Conclusion

In conclusion, Mad Casino & Sportsbook is a dynamic online gaming platform that caters to both casino game lovers and sports betting aficionados. With an extensive variety of games, competitive betting options, generous bonuses, and a commitment to security and customer support, it’s no wonder that Mad Casino is gaining popularity among online gamblers. Whether you’re a seasoned player or just starting your gambling journey, Mad Casino & Sportsbook promises an exciting and rewarding experience. Don’t miss out on the fun – dive into the world of Mad Casino today!